Public Health Alarm in Indore as Azad Nagar Reports Contaminated Water Supply; Calls for Immediate Audit Intensify

Residents of Indore’s Azad Nagar are raising alarms over the distribution of contaminated water allegedly infested with insects. Following the public outcry, social activist Umang Singhar has demanded an immediate water audit and ICMR intervention, warning of a potential public health crisis similar to the Bhagirathpura incident if the Indore Municipal Corporation fails to act.

The specter of a public health crisis looms over Indore’s Azad Nagar as residents report the distribution of highly contaminated tap water, with some accounts alleging the presence of visible insects in the supply. The deteriorating quality of potable water has sparked sharp criticism from social activists and community leaders, who are now demanding accountability from the Indore Municipal Corporation (IMC) and state authorities to prevent a localized outbreak of waterborne diseases.

Drawing a grim parallel to the previous health scares in Bhagirathpura, social activist Umang Singhar has voiced serious concerns regarding administrative negligence. In a formal appeal directed at the Mayor, the Urban Administration Minister, and the Chief Minister, Singhar underscored the urgency of the situation, characterizing the current water quality as a direct threat to the well-being of thousands of citizens. He argued that the recurrence of such issues reflects a systemic failure in the city’s water management infrastructure and called for a comprehensive, transparent water audit to identify the root cause of the contamination.

The demand for intervention has escalated beyond local civic bodies, with calls for the Indian Council of Medical Research (ICMR) to dispatch a specialized team to collect and analyze water samples from the affected areas. Advocates for the residents believe that only an independent scientific investigation can provide an accurate assessment of the biological risks present in the water supply. The pressure is now mounting on the IMC to not only address the immediate blockage or seepage causing the pollution but also to ensure that the "Cleanest City in India" tag is reflected in the safety of its primary utilities.

As the situation develops, the residents of Azad Nagar remain in a state of high alert, fearing that a delay in administrative action could lead to a repeat of past tragedies where contaminated water resulted in widespread illness.
